Don’t pity me, Tinubu tells Nigerians

The President-elect, Bola Tinubu, on Sunday night, asked Nigerians not to pity him over the enormous task of nation building before him.

While alluding to challenges bedevelling the country, Tinubu said he was well aware of the task he set out for and do not expect pity from Nigerians.

Tinubu, a former Lagos State governor, stated this during inauguration dinner and gala night.

He rather asked Nigerians to him accountable on his promises, adding that he campaigned to be elected because of the challenges bedevelling the country.

“We have corruption, insecurity and many problems confronting us… but don’t pity me. I asked for the job. I campaigned for it. No excuses.

“I will live up to expectation, I promise you,” Tinubu said.
